An Acail, originally an agricultural barn, is now a converted self catering cottage (2014) and has been awarded four stars through the Visit Scotland quality assurance scheme. The cottage is just a short drive from Stornoway town centre and is perfectly located for exploring the

Islands of Lewis and Harris. The Islands boast beautiful beaches, many historical sites, and there are numerous walks. Ranging from simple strolls to more adventurous rambles. The accommodation is on two levels. On the ground floor there is an open plan kitchen/dining and living room and access to the first floor. Also on the ground floor is the master bedroom (with super king size bed) and luxury bathroom (with spa bath and a water fall shower).The bathroom has Jack and Jill doors, so can be accessed from the bedroom or hall way. The bathroom also has a TV and blue tooth speakers. The upstairs is accessed through the living area and stairs which can be lit at floor level. There are two bedrooms upstairs both with ensuite shower rooms. Both these rooms have twin beds. To the rear of the cottage there is a patio area and a large picnic table. There is also an outbuilding which houses the boiler for the central heating and the laundry facilities - washing machine, ironing area, and clothes pulley and tumble dryer. These facilities are for your sole use. There is also an outdoor drying area. An Acail is a warm cosy house with oil central heating which can be fully controlled by you.
